2016-11-11 6 views
1

ユニットテストを行う前にtravis上で実行する必要のある空のデータベーススクリプトがあります。これは、データベーススキーマを設定し、いくつかのフィールドに入力します。どうすればこのことができますか?私たちはMySQLが今まで正しく作成されており、スクリプトを実行するだけです。TravisでMySQLスクリプトを実行する

答えて

1

これは私のために働いた、私は


language: php 
php: 
    - '5.5' 
    - '5.6' 
service: 
    - mysql 
install: 
    - composer install 
before_install: 
    - mysql -e 'CREATE DATABASE IF NOT EXISTS baladay;' 
    - mysql -u root --default-character-set=utf8 baladay < scripts/bd.sql 
script: 
    - vendor/bin/phpunit 
.travis.yml私のファイルを構成し
関連する問題